Re: svn-Herausforderung: alle valid-user=rw, einige ro
Hallo,
On Friday 01 June 2012 12:25
Michael Renner <michael.renner@gmx.de> wrote:
> [..]
> # Experimentelles File um rw und ro Zugriff zu erlauben
>
> [/]
> anonymous = r
> * = rw
>
>
>
> Der Ausschnitt aus der httpd:
> <Location /test>
> DAV svn
> SVNListParentPath off
> AuthType Basic
> AuthName "Repository zum testen und experimentieren"
> AuthUserFile /space/svn/etc/test.htpasswd
> AuthzSVNAccessFile /space/svn/etc/test_authz.svnaccess
> Require valid-user
> SVNPath /space/svn/Repositories/test
> </Location>
>
>
> Die test_authz.svnaccess wird zwar berücksichtig, aber anonymous kann
> weiterhin schreiben. Die Reihenfolge ändert auch nichts.
> Wie könnte man den ro Access sonst erreichen?
Versuch mal, das ganze über Gruppen zu realisieren und auf das "*" zu
verzichten. Ich hatte mal eine Lösung im Einsatz, die in etwa so
aussah (zudem mit SVNParentPath, da ich das bequemer fand):
[groups]
group1 = user1, user2
group2 = user1, user3
all = anonymous, user1, user2, user3
[/]
@all = r
[repo1:/]
@group1 = rw
[repo2:/]
@group2 = rw
Hilfreich ist auch
http://svnbook.red-bean.com/en/1.7/svn.serverconfig.pathbasedauthz.html
Viele Grüße
Alexander
Reply to: